Well folks, Just returned from Panopticon West 1984 in Columbus, Ohio,
and again the Prydonian Renegades did a fine job.  Special Guests
were Colin Baker (Doctor #6), John Nathan-Turner (Producer), Gary
Downie (Production Manager and Choreographer), and Marion Wyatt Baker
(Mrs. Who), all of whom took off the weekend from working on the
newest story "ATTACK OF THE CYBERMEN" (22nd season).  The last three
stories from the 21st season (Planet of Fire, Caves of Androzani, and
The Twin Dilemma) were shown.

The Art auction had some very nice items, including some props from
the show.  A Gallifreyan Guard Helmet went for $275, and a picture
of the late Richard Hurndall (First Doctor in "The Five Doctors",
died in April this year) went for $550.  Other interesting items
from the show that were available included a Silurian gun and a
working Sea-Devil gun (from the Pertwee era), and some very nice
artwork by (my personal favorites) Gail Bennent and Cheryl W. Duval.

Unfortunately, the very last autographed picture of the late William
Hartnell, donated by his widow Heather, was *STOLEN!*  But, fear not...
Sunday morning a collection was taken to replace it, and that collection
resulted in $1650.00 from all of the fans.  After the money was handed
over to the convention staff, it turns out that the picture was recovered,
although it was not done cheaply.  By the way, all profits from this
year's convention will be going to the Special Olympics, so you see
there are a LOT of people who will be happy about this!

Several running jokes made it through the convention this year, one
was quite literally accidental.  On the first day of the convention
one of the staff (dressed as Sgt. Benton) was bringing orange-juice
to the guests on stage when she tripped!!  The rest of the weekend
turned into a running joke.  Every time Benton brought up juice,
SOMETHING happened!  It ended with two pitchers of water being dumped
on the last day.

The other running joke concerned a cat.  Colin and his wife own five
cats currently (named Eric, Lolita, Morris, WEEEEE, and the fifth
yet to be named, although a fan suggested Serendipity) (WEEEEE is
the sound the fourth cat makes, not Meow) and the rumor of a Gallifreyan
cat running loose in the hotel made for a lot of fun.  Rumors of the cat
being rather large and vicious (like a Gremlin) came through, as well as
the report of an attack on a Gopher, a bowl of caviar, and a cake.  Also,
a rumor that a man dressed in black with a gotee (sp?) was holding the
cat for ransom also arose...   More info is available, but that would
be spoiling it 8-) 8-) 8-)
